Building your “soft skills”

I often advise PhD students on career planning and the many options available to them in and out of academia. When I ask about specific skills, a lot of them focus only on their research/technical skills, i.e. “hard skills” such as genetics, cell biology, computer science, chemistry or pharmacology. When I inquire about “soft skills,” I am often met with looks of confusion. This blog provides a few examples of “soft-skills” to help scientists build and realize these important “other skills.”
